logo

Output 23bc3b8a5c2f7093d140ecba04000963c904216e8f39cbc9def258c1f4f3adde:6

value
579950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b39dee8b08841aff120d115c7aec2111d2f69b6 OP_EQUAL
address
3QbNrd4Yq5HMcAc2ECJn2B8LHEM3g3a8J6
transaction
23bc3b8a5c2f7093d140ecba04000963c904216e8f39cbc9def258c1f4f3adde